James A. Robinson
Author
James A. Robinson, a political scientist and an economist, is one of nine current University Professors at the University of Chicago. He is well known for the international bestseller “Why Nations Fail: The Origins of Power, Prosperity and Poverty,” which he co-wrote with Daron Acemoglu. Their new book, “The Narrow Corridor: States, Societies and the Fate of Liberty” (Penguin), explores how liberty flourishes in some states but falls to authoritarianism or anarchy in others, and it explains how it can continue to thrive despite new threats.
